**Mgmt Meeting Minutes — Retiring the Brightline Range**

Quick recap for sales leads at Fenholt Supplies: we agreed to retire the Brightline fixture range by year-end. Remaining stock moves to clearance pricing next month, and accounts on standing orders get migrated to the Lumetta range. Trade-in incentives were approved in principle. The confidential note on next steps sits just below.

board note of bajof-bajeg: The pricing group signed off on a budget of $13.4 million for Project Sildor. The renewal with Lamixek Holdings closes at $48.9 million a year, 49 percent above the last contract.

# Ledgerpane Limits

Ledgerpane is the audit-log viewer for the Quorrin platform. Queries are capped per session; exports are capped per day. Exceeding either returns a 429 — wait, don't retry-loop. Quota bumps require a ticket to the platform team. Current enforced limits are listed below.

constants for tageg-kagag:
QUOTAS = {
    "kelax": 495,
    "istath": 366,
    "tammir": 108,
    "novdor": 730,
    "casax": 816,
    "quenael": 874,
    "pelius": 403,
}

**Ticket: DeployParrot bot config drift**

Plugin authors: the DeployParrot status bot in our Quillbrook workspace has drifted from its documented baseline. Channel routing rules and the poll interval no longer match the plugin contract published last quarter, which may break webhook-based extensions. Please validate your integrations against the actual running configuration, reproduced below for accuracy.

service settings:
PRAIX_LOG_LEVEL=error
PRAIX_METRICS_HOST=metrics.praix.qorvelcorp.corp
PRAIX_POOL_SIZE=16

## Webhook Retries — Tallis Platform Onboarding

Tallis delivers webhooks with at-least-once semantics: failed deliveries retry on an exponential backoff (1m, 5m, 30m, 2h) for up to 24 hours, after which events land in the dead-letter queue. Consumers must be idempotent; use the delivery ID to deduplicate. To inspect the staging dead-letter queue, unlock it with the recovery passphrase below.

recovery phrase for kajop-yagef: istael-ulaius